BRS slams Congress government over false cases against MLA Padi Kaushik Reddy

Former MLA Rasamayi Balakishan questions why no cases were filed against Congress activists who attacked BRS office at Bhongir

Hyderabad: Former MLA Rasamayi Balakishan launched a scathing attack on the Congress government, charging it with filing false cases against BRS MLA Padi Kaushik Reddy to harass him. He condemned the filing of four cases against Kaushik Reddy for confronting a turncoat MLA in Karimnagar on Sunday.
Speaking to mediapersons at Telangana Bhavan on Monday, Balakishan criticised Jagtial MLA Sanjay Kumar for defecting to the ruling Congress, after getting elected on behalf of the BRS. “Let Sanjay quit his MLA post and contest on Congress’ six guarantees,” he challenged.
The former MLA pointed out contradictions in the assault allegations against Kaushik Reddy, noting that Sanjay himself denied being attacked. “If no assault occurred, why were cases filed against Kaushik Reddy? This exposes the Congress’ agenda to stifle opposition,” he said.
He came down heavily on the Congress government for ignoring attacks on BRS offices by the Congress cadre, targeting BRS leaders. He questioned why no cases were filed against Congress activists who attacked the Bhongir office of the BRS.
Balakishan warned the Congress government not to mistake BRS’ silence for weakness, vowing to fight against its anarchic rule. He dismissed Sanjay’s statements as baseless rhetoric and appreciated Kaushik Reddy for standing up against oppression.
